Baker Hughes Incorporated (“Baker Hughes”) announced today that its subsidiaries have signed an agreement to sell a package of assets including two stimulation vessels (the HR Hughes and Blue Ray) and certain other assets used to perform sand control and stimulation services in the US Gulf of Mexico

The Belgian dredging- and environmental group DEME has just been awarded two important contracts in Mexico and Malaysia. With several deepwater projects successfully completed over the last few years and in recognition of the growth potential in South-East Asia, Jumbo Offshore has decided to open a new Regional Office in Perth, Australia. The office is headed by Mr Sjoerd Meijer, Business Development Manager Australia

Royal Boskalis Westminster N.V. has been awarded the second phase of the construction of the LNG import terminal of Cuyutlán on the west coast of Mexico. AWE Limited, as Operator of the Tui Field on behalf of the Tui Joint Venture, advises that production from the Tui area oil fields for the financial year ended 30 June 2010 was 4.83 million barrels.
